Latest Patents

Yen's latest patents focus on methods and apparatuses for intelligent scheduling of network evaluation in wireless LAN networks. His inventions include an information handling system that features a wireless interface for transmitting data frames via a wireless link. This system operates within a wireless neighborhood that consists of multiple wireless base transceiver stations (BTSs). The technology employs a carrier sense multiple access (CSMA) media access control protocol, which utilizes back-off time periods to prevent packet collisions. Additionally, the system incorporates a radio scanning modem that scans various radio channels for BTSs during specific time intervals. The processor within the system implements a network evaluation scheduling system that detects the load of each BTS and determines alternative wireless links based on traffic load.
